Avoid
Further Mesothelioma Injury Through Prompt
Treatment |

Mesothelioma
injury can be classified into three main
groups, Pleural (chest), Peritoneal (abdominal)
and Pericardial (heart). All three types
of Mesothelioma injury are mainly cause
through exposure to an Asbestos related
substance.
Mesothelioma injury arises when the Mesothelioma
cells surrounding the lungs, heart, or abdominal
organs become cancerous. The Mesothelioma
cells change to form nodules, which can
then clump together to form a tumor, or
tumors around the organ.
In more extreme cases of Mesothelioma Cancer,
the Mesothelioma tumor can break through
the walls of the organs that it surrounds
and cause internal damage to the organ.
Also, in some cases the Cancer can travel
through the blood stream and affect other
organs, not directly surrounded by the original
Mesothelioma Cancerous Cells.
The origins of Mesothelioma injury begin
when a person is exposed to an asbestos
related substance. The person either inhales
the Asbestos fibers, or the fibers enter
the skin. These fibers either lodge in the
lungs, or travel through the body and affect
the heart, or abdominal organs.
The bodies natural defense system will attempt
to eradicate the fibers from the body, through
attempts to expel the fibers. However, some
fibers will become lodged in the Mesothelioma
cell layers that provide a protective layer
around the lungs, heart and abdominal area.
Over time, the Mesothelioma cells surrounding
the fibers, can change consistency and become
cancerous. It is at this stage that the
Mesothelioma injury begins to occur, as
it turns into Mesothelioma.

In order to prevent the adverse affects
of Mesothelioma injury, Mesothelioma doctors
have been implementing various treatments
that aim to prevent further damage. Some
of these treatments include, surgery, chemotherapy,
radiation therapy and immune augmentative
therapy.
In regard to Mesothelioma Cancer, Surgery
aims to remove the Cancerous Mesothelioma
cells, while chemotherapy uses drugs to
kill the Cancerous cells. Radiation therapy
also aims to eliminate the Mesothelioma
cells, while immune augmentative therapy
aims to restore the body’s natural immune
system to a level in which it can be effective
in helping to fight the effects of Mesothelioma
Cancer.
